About the Role
As the Performance Analyst, you will provide the UGP Manager with all the data and information needed to correctly manage the UGP, through performance monitoring and analysis (i.e. lines, materials, efficiencies, quality, labour, etc.) and directional reporting preparation.
Main Responsibilities
Budget
- Collaborates, with the UGP Manager and the Controlling Unit, in the production budget elaboration
- Support the UGP and Maintenance Manager in preparing and supplying information for the investment budget elaboration
- Elaborates, together with the UGP Manager, the general expenditure budget (consumable, training, …)
- Performance of production lines
Monitoring performances and productive factors
